DELUXE OLD-FASHIONED CHOCOLATE CAKE LAYERS



Deluxe Old-Fashioned Chocolate Cake Layers image

My absolute 'go-to' recipe for chocolate cake. The brown sugar gives it depth. This recipe is for cake layers only. Use your favorite frosting. From the Hershey's Test Kitchens.

Provided by gailanng

Categories     Dessert

Time 1h5m

Yield 2 cake layers, 12-14 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 10

3 ounces baking chocolate (3 squares)
1/3 cup water
3/4 cup butter
2 1/4 cups firmly packed brown sugar
2 eggs
1 teaspoon vanilla
2 1/4 cups unsifted cake flour or 2 cups all-purpose flour
1 teaspoon baking soda
1/2 teaspoon salt
1 cup water

Steps:

  • Break chocolate into pieces; place in small saucepan with 1/3 cup water. Stir constantly over low heat until chocolate has melted. Cool. (This can be successfully done in microwave. Go slow so as not to burn the chocolate.).
  • Cream butter and sugar in large mixing bowl until very light and fluffy. Add eggs and vanilla; beat well. Blend in chocolate.
  • Combine flour, baking soda and salt; add alternately with 1 cup water on low speed. Beat just until well-blended. Pour batter into well-greased and floured cake pans.
  • Tip: outline a piece of waxed paper the size of the bottom of the cake pan and cut with sissors to size and place in bottom. No need to grease or butter pan.
  • Bake at 350 degrees. Cake is done if toothpick inserted in center comes out clean. Cool 10 minutes. Remove from pans by inverting onto wire rack. If using waxed paper liner, remove and discard. Cool cake layers completely before frosting.
  • Baking Times:.
  • Two 8-inch layer pans -- 35-40 minutes.
  • Two 9-inch layer pans -- 30-35 minutes.
  • Two 8- or 9-inch square pans -- 30-35 minutes.

FUDGY DELUXE CHOCOLATE CAKE



Fudgy Deluxe Chocolate Cake image

The only chocolate cake recipe I ever use. Very dense, moist, fudgey and rich! Works for me every time. The super fudgey frosting totally makes it. I've also made it in a 9 x 13 pan and it worked great. I've tried it with dark brown sugar and it was delicious. I've tried using butter instead of margarine, but the cake didn't seem to hold together quite as well.

Provided by Jillster

Categories     Dessert

Time 1h

Yield 1 cake, 12-15 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 15

3 ounces unsweetened chocolate
2 cups flour
2 teaspoons baking soda
1/2 teaspoon salt
1/2 cup margarine
2 1/4 cups brown sugar
3 eggs
1 1/2 teaspoons vanilla
1 cup sour cream
1 cup boiling water
4 ounces unsweetened chocolate
1/2 cup butter
1 lb confectioners' sugar
1/2 cup milk
2 teaspoons vanilla

Steps:

  • THE CAKE:.
  • Preheat the oven to 350.
  • Grease and flour two 9" round pans. (I line the bottoms with parchment or wax paper because I'm paranoid, but not necessary).
  • Melt chocolate in microwave and set aside to cool.
  • Mix flour, soda, and salt and set aside.
  • Beat the margarine in a mixer until it's soft
  • Add brown sugar and eggs and beat until light and fluffy (about 5 min.).
  • Beat in vanilla and cooled melted chocolate.
  • Mix in sour cream and dry ingredients alternately, and then beat well.
  • Stir in boiling water (batter will be thin and runny).
  • Pour batter into pans evenly, and bake at 350 degrees for 25-35 minutes, or until toothpick comes out cleanly.
  • Allow to cool on a rack for 10 minutes, and then remove from pans.
  • Allow cakes to cool completely, and then frost.
  • SUPER FUDGEY FROSTING:.
  • Melt chocolate and butter together ( I microwave it) and allow to cool
  • Combine milk, vanilla, and confectioner's sugar in a mixer and mix on low.
  • Add melted butter and chocolate.
  • Whip until frosting is of spreading consistency.(If butter/chocolate mixture is still warm, it takes a bit of time to set up).

DELUXE CHOCOLATE CAKE



Deluxe Chocolate Cake image

Provided by Food Network

Categories     dessert

Yield Two 8-inch layers

Number Of Ingredients 17

2 cups (200 grams) sifted cake flour
1 teaspoon baking soda
1/4 teaspoon salt
1/2 cup (50 grams) unsifted cocoa powder
1/2 cup lukewarm water
1/2 cup buttermilk, room temperature
1/2 cup water
2 teaspoons vanilla
2 large eggs, room temperature
4 ounces (1 stick) unsalted butter, room temperature
1 cup (200 grams) granulated sugar
1 cup (200 grams) light brown sugar, packed
8 ounces semisweet or bittersweet chocolate, finely chopped
1 cup heavy cream
1 cup heavy cream, whipped
10 ounces semisweet chocolate, finely chopped
1 cup heavy cream

Steps:

  • Adjust rack in lower third of oven. Preheat oven to 350 degrees. Grease and flour two 8-inch round cake pans, and insert parchment paper or waxed paper to line the bottoms. Sift the flour, baking soda, and salt onto a sheet of waxed paper; set aside. Place the cocoa in a 1-quart mixing bowl. Add the 1/2 cup lukewarm water, and whisk to combine; set aside to cool. Pour the buttermilk, the 1/2 cup water, and the vanilla into a liquid cup measure. Crack the eggs into a small bowl, and whisk together to combine the yolks and whites.
  • Place the butter in the bowl of a heavy-duty mixer, preferably fitted with a flat beater. Cream the butter on medium speed until the butter is smooth and lighter in color, about 30 to 45 seconds. Reduce the speed to low, add the sugars in a steady stream. When all the sugar is added, stop the machine, and scrape the mixture clinging to the side of the bowl into the center. The mixture will appear sandy. Increase the speed to medium again, and cream until the mixture is light in color, is fluffy in texture, and appears as one mass, about 5 to 7 minutes. With the mixer still on medium speed, pour the eggs slowly at first. Continue to cream, scraping the sides of the bowl at least once, until the mixture appears fluffy and velvety. Stop the machine and spoon in the cooled cocoa mixture, resume at medium speed and mix just until incorporated.
  • Using a rubber spatula, stir in one-fourth of the flour mixture. Then one-third of the buttermilk mixture, stirring to blend together. Repeat this procedure, alternating dry and liquid. With each addition, scrape the sides of the bowl, and continue mixing until smooth, never adding liquid if any flour is visible.
  • Pour the batter into the pans and spread it level. Bake for 25 minutes, or until the baked surface springs back slightly when touched lightly in the center and the sides contract from the pan.
  • Place the cake pans on a rack to cool for 5 to 10 minutes. With mitts, tilt and rotate pans gently tapping them on the counter to see if the cake releases from sides.
  • Put the chocolate in a medium bowl. In a small saucepan, heat the heavy cream just to the boil. Remove from heat. Pour over chocolate and whisk until chocolate melts and mixture is smooth and shiny.
  • ASSEMBLING THE DESSERT:
  • Split each layer of cake in half horizontally and place one layer, cut side up, on a cardboard round. Spread with one-third of the ganache filling. Center a second layer on top of the first, and spread it with one-third of the ganache filling. Place another layer, cut side up, on top, and spread with remaining filling and turn he last layer upside down, and center it over the filling.
  • Frost the cake with the whipped cream. Place the cake on a wire rack, then set it on a sheet pan that will fit the dimensions of your freezer. Place in the freezer for 40 minutes only, (this is just enough time to chill the whipped cream frosting so it's firm to the touch, not soft.) While the cake is in the freezer, prepare the dark chocolate glaze. Put the chocolate in a medium bowl. In a small saucepan, heat the heavy cream just to the boil. Remove from heat. Pour over chocolate and whisk until chocolate melts and mixture is smooth and shiny. Set aside to cool to body temperature.
  • Set the cake on its wire rack over a baking pan with sides (like a jelly roll pan) on top of a turntable (or lazy susan.) Pour almost all of the chocolate glaze over the center of the cake. Using a long, flexible metal icing spatula, use just a few strokes to spread the glaze over the top of the cake so the glaze runs down over the sides. Rotate the turntable as you spread. Use the spatula to scoop up excess glaze to touch it to any bare spots on the sides of the cake to cover them. Place the cake on a serving plate. Refrigerate until 30 to 60 minutes before serving. Using a serrated knife, dipped into hot water after each slice, cut dessert into wedges.
